Where is Gazipur?

Imagine a big, green area in the middle of Bangladesh. That's Gazipur! It's part of a larger region called Dhaka Division. This district is pretty big, about as big as 250,000 soccer fields put together! It has warm weather, perfect for growing lots of plants and trees. There are also some really cool natural places to explore, like big parks filled with nature's wonders.

A Place with Big Stories!

Gazipur has been around for a very long time and has seen many important moments. It was a special place during big events in Bangladesh's history. One very famous person from Gazipur was the first Prime Minister of Bangladesh, Tajuddin Ahmad. His home is here, reminding everyone of the important history that happened in this district.

Super Big Get-Togethers!

Get ready for a WOW fact! Gazipur is famous for hosting the Bishwa Ijtema. This is the second-largest meeting of Muslims from all over the world. Imagine over 5 million people coming together โ€“ that's more people than live in some whole countries! It's a truly massive and special event that happens every year.

Fun Places and Learning!

Gazipur is a place where fun and learning happen! It has a safari park where you can see amazing animals, and a national park with lots of trees and nature. Plus, there are many schools and universities where people go to learn new things. It's also home to a special 'Hi-Tech City' where new technology is developed.
